Best Laid Plans…

This post contains affiliate links to products mentioned. For more information, read my disclosure policy.

I know it’s not going to shock you to hear me say this, but sometimes things just don’t work out the way I plan.  Like last night’s date night that we spent at the after hours clinic.  Or, last week’s “date night that wasn’t” either. Or, the cake I made for someone’s birthday a week too early.  Or how I was going to keep my kitchen clean.  Or finish my laundry.  Or…you get the idea.

I can’t help but remember what James wrote: “Now listen you who say, ‘Today or tomorrow we will go to this or that city, spend a year there and carry on business and make money.  Why you do not even know what will happen tomorrow.'” (James 4:13-14)

Clearly.

But God does.  His word says that all the days ordained for me were written in his book before one of them came to be. (Psalm 139:16)

That’s a good thing.  It means that he planned for our little one to start crying BEFORE we left last night, not after.  Same with the little getaway we had planned last week.  We weren’t far from home when we found out plans had to change, and what would have been a fun date night turned into a wonerful time of family fun.  And that cake?  My little girl took it to school the day after I thought it was due and her class was able to celebrate her taeacher’s birthday in a special way. (I had no idea it was her teacher’s birthday when I offered to bring the cake…God is so good!)

And, about the laundry…when I admitted to another mom this morning the state our laundry is in, she said, “OH!  That makes me feel so much better!”  My mountain of laundry offered her a load of encouragement.  You see, God can even use our dirty clothes to do his will.
